Transaction dfac62ca53d50ae30ab0a0332de5df54d78b88910bc459f09416ba87fb86788e
1 Input
1 Output
-
dfac62ca53d50ae30ab0a0332de5df54d78b88910bc459f09416ba87fb86788e:0
- value
- 1000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cdca3851845e3a718dcec7895544efcdcd68e90 OP_EQUAL
- address
- 3MpptzhCsaTUqMMoYi7gHB8oPrXRVN8zKP